I’m a bit out of touch with the filmmaking community in my hometown of Erie, Pa. It’s amazing what moving just 100 miles will do. Anyway, time for a little catch up.
First up is John C. Lyons, who just completed his first feature film titled schism. You can catch up on the production with my In the Lyons Den series. Well, Mr. Lyons is now selling tickets to the Erie premiere of the film. schism will debut at Edinboro University April 17 & 18.
Also worth noting is the production Virgin Pockets by Paul Gorman and the gang at GMD films. They sent me a screener a few months back, which I’ve still yet to sit down with. The film got some good coverage in Billiards Digest (PDF) and thanks to the wonders of the Internet you can watch it through GMD’s VOD service. You can also go the old fashioned route and purchase the DVD.
